- Water reservoir dam being constructed by villagers in Korea, ca. 1964.
- Description
- Kyung Sang North province, Pi Bong Village. Water reservoir dam being constructed by villagers with surplus foods donated by Church World Service, a government engineer and government loan and village contributions - a 30 year old dream made possible through the efforts of Rev. Stan Wilson of Andong (United Presbyterian missionary.)

- Women helping build dam in Korean village, ca. 1964.
- Description
- Kyung Sang North province, Pi Bong Village. Women tamping earth fill on top of dam using tree stumps.
